Leach International Corporation · 3 weeks ago
Software Verification Engineer
Leach International Corporation designs and manufactures relays and electronic control devices primarily for the aerospace and defense industry. The Software Verification Engineer will design, develop, document, test, and verify embedded software and systems for aerospace applications, ensuring compliance with RTCA/DO-178 processes throughout the development lifecycle.
ElectronicsIndustrialManufacturingMechanical EngineeringProduct DesignSupply Chain Management
Responsibilities
Develop and execute verification plans in accordance with RTCA/DO-178C requirements
Create and implement detailed test cases and procedures for software verification
Conduct and document verification tests, compiling test data, and creating comprehensive test reports, including the Software Verification Report (SVR)
Review and validate customer requirements for completeness and testability
Decompose system-level requirements into clear subsystem and component-level requirements
Design and develop robust automated testing systems for verification and manufacturing of power products
Coordinate testing activities on assigned projects in a multi-disciplinary team
Develop embedded software with structured architecture and good documentation
Mentor junior team members on technical and process best practices
Interface with DER and SQA for successful software release and certification
Maintain the highest ethical standards and adhere to company ethics and business conduct policies
Performs other duties as required
Qualification
Required
Bachelor's Degree in Computer Science or Electrical Engineering from an accredited four-year university
Minimum of 5 years of experience performing embedded C software verification activities, specifically within an avionics or safety-critical environment
Minimum of 5 years of professional experience in Python programming
Ability to identify, track, and resolve verification process/environment/artifact issues in a formal configuration and change control environment
In-depth experience with the RTCA/DO-178C development process at a high criticality level (Level A or B)
Successfully interface with DER and SQA stakeholders to support software release and certification
Proven experience with Unit level Testing and Requirement-Based Testing
Experience with Hardware & Software Integration Testing
Proficiency in utilizing IBM Rational DOORS (or similar tools) for requirements capture and traceability management
Familiarity with standard software development methodologies and tools for real-time systems
Excellent written and verbal communication skills for technical documentation and team collaboration
Highly organized, detail-oriented, and capable of managing/prioritizing multiple tasks effectively
Preferred
Master of Science Degree in Electrical/Software/Computer Engineering
Proficiency in using LabVIEW and the ARM C Compiler for development and testing
Experience with communication protocols including Ethernet, CAN, MIL-STD-1553, RS-485, UART, SPI, and I2C
Familiarity with the RTCA/DO-254 development process (or similar safety-critical hardware development standards)
Practical experience and knowledge of the VHDL hardware description language
Strong foundation in both analog and digital design is desirable
Familiarity with High Power testing and instrumentation (e.g., 270 VDC and 115 VAC)
Ability to critically analyze technical elements of specifications to ensure optimal project outcomes
Pragmatic and risk-aware thinker with ability to prioritize tasks and effectively mitigate risks
Company
Leach International Corporation
Leach International Corporation manufactures power distribution components such as relays and contactors for a wide range of industries.
Funding
Current Stage
Late StageRecent News
HongKong Business
2025-07-22
2025-02-17
Company data provided by crunchbase